Sinn Féin MP Chris Hazzard has urged the British government to create a separate, ring-fenced agricultural support package for Northern Ireland farmers.

Hazzard said the current funding system is failing local farmers and rural communities.

He stated that local farmers deserve certainty that they will receive the support package they are entitled to.

Hazzard noted that changes to this vital funding since 2021 have caused farming families to lose out significantly.

He said local farmers are now facing a severe disadvantage compared to their counterparts south of the border because of a Brexit they did not vote for.

Hazzard added that local farmers continue to punch well above their weight and that it is time London recognised their contribution and provided a fair level of support.
